Musical performances, political meetings, and other activities will not be allowed to take place at the Galle Face Green in Sri Lanka, except for religious activities. The Sri Lanka Ports Authority will carry out a corporate social responsibility program and has already spent Rs. 220 million on development programs, with Rs. 6.6 million spent on repairing damages caused during the ‘Aragalaya’ period. The Cabinet made this decision because the Galle Face Green areas were meant for the public to spend their leisure hours peacefully and not for rallies and large gatherings.
This will effect from 20th April.
